Core Insights - Intel Corporation is in advanced talks to acquire AI start-up SambaNova Systems for approximately $1.6 billion, which will enhance Intel's AI capabilities by providing ready-made AI architecture, software stacks, and engineering talent [1][8] - The acquisition aims to modernize Intel's CPUs with AI chips and software, offering a complete AI system to cloud and enterprise customers, while also increasing manufacturing strength [2][8] - Intel has launched new AI-powered chips that are faster and more energy-efficient, gaining traction in AI infrastructure with Super Micro Computer choosing Intel's Xeon 6 processors for high-performance enterprise servers [3][4] Company Developments - Intel is collaborating with Cisco to create an integrated platform for distributed AI workloads and has secured a $5 billion investment from NVIDIA to develop advanced AI technologies [4] - The company has seen a stock rally of 79.3% over the past year, outperforming the industry growth of 31.1% [7] - Current earnings estimates for 2025 have increased by 128.6% to $0.32, while estimates for 2026 have decreased by 10.7% to $0.59 [10] Competitive Landscape - Intel faces competition from Advanced Micro Devices (AMD) and Qualcomm, with Qualcomm focusing on advanced chips for AI-powered PCs and launching AI 200 and AI 250 chips [5] - AMD is expanding its AI business through new MI350 series accelerators and partnerships with major companies like Amazon and Microsoft, and has a long-term deal with OpenAI to power large AI systems using AMD's Instinct GPUs starting in 2026 [6]
